《劍13》Test 2 雅思大作文解析及范文題目:
“Some people think that people nowadays have too many choices. To what extent do you agree or disagree?
”審題關鍵詞:too, 貶義,含義是excessive,redundant
高分范文
01
Modern society is characterized by [“以xxx為特點”] material abundance [“物質(zhì)方面的豐富”] and many lifestyle choices. Although many people think that they are spoilt for choices [習語,“選擇太多以至于無從選擇”], I tend to think otherwise.
02
Admittedly, stores offer a wide range of commodities for people to choose from; however, what a shopper [語境下具體的人群,而不寬泛稱為people/person] can actually afford is only a limited number of them. In addition, although job vacancies are plentiful, what an applicant[語境下具體的人群,而不寬泛稱為people/person] is qualified or suited for is often only a few. The same principle applies to [“同樣的原則適用于”]one’s personal life. Many single males or females [語境下具體的人群,而不寬泛稱為people/person] may have the misconception that an ideal partner must be selected out of many candidates; as a matter of fact, they may never meet that many people or deserve many of them. In brief, one can be confined by [“受限于”] his or her capability, having [伴隨狀語] not too many choices. [特殊的段落結構:段落中心句在段落最后]
03
Another reason is that the existing variety of choices actually falls behind the diversity of individual preferences. In other words, no matter how numerous today’s options are, the diverse personal desires are more. Those people who argue for the redundancy of choices adopt a rather narrow perspective and misconceive of the plenty of options as excessive existents. For example, when they choose a particular product, they may meanwhile consider other options unnecessary. However, taking a broad view, one may find that those seemingly excess options are popular among particular demographics and that there are many people’s needs that have not been met yet because what is available for people to choose from is still short. Hence, how could we think that the choices are too many?
04
In conclusion, people nowadays do not have many choices. Conversely, the options available are limited for both internal [“內(nèi)在的/內(nèi)部的”] and external [“外在的/外部的”] factors.
